Sanfoja, Sweet rig. I love the black wheels. You can use duplicolor bed liner on those mirrors. Just scuff them up, wash them off, tape and spray evenly. I did my whole grill and after two months of winter driving not one chip!!! Even if it doesnt work out for you you can always have them re-done.
